In order to solve this equation we need to have variables x on one side and the numbers on the other side of the equation. Numbers and variables that will change sides will have their sign changed from + to - and vice versa.
3x-5=9
3x=9+5
3x=14
Divide both sides with 3.
3x/3 = 14/3
x=14/3
